Join us in listening to Dr. Andrew Van Leuven discuss his experience with the economic development of rural communities in Oklahoma! 

 Dr. Van Leuven is an assistant professor in the Agricultural Economics department at Oklahoma State University. He will share his experience with studying planning, geography, and public policy at OSU. 

The event will take place on Thursday, February 9th from 12:00-1:15 in Gould Hall Rm. 345. For more information, contact Dr. John Harris at johncharris@ou.edu.

OU Student Journal Earns 2026 Douglas Haskell Award

Telesis, a journal produced by students in the University of Oklahoma Christopher C. Gibbs College of Architecture, has earned first place in the 2026 Douglas Haskell Award for Student Journals for its seventh volume, “Unfold.” This marks the fourth time the publication has earned recognition for excellence in student architectural journalism. It shares the honor with student journals from Columbia University, University of Michigan, and Cal Poly.
